当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象储存和文件储存的区别,对象存储与文件存储,应用场景解析及区别探讨

对象储存和文件储存的区别,对象存储与文件存储,应用场景解析及区别探讨

对象存储与文件存储在数据管理上存在显著差异。对象存储以数据块为单位,适用于大规模非结构化数据存储;文件存储则基于文件系统,适用于结构化数据存储。应用场景解析显示,对象存...

对象存储与文件存储在数据管理上存在显著差异。对象存储以数据块为单位,适用于大规模非结构化数据存储;文件存储则基于文件系统,适用于结构化数据存储。应用场景解析显示,对象存储适合大数据、云存储等,而文件存储适用于文件服务器、企业级应用。两者在性能、扩展性、数据管理等方面存在明显区别。

随着互联网技术的飞速发展,数据量呈爆炸式增长,如何高效、安全地存储和管理海量数据成为企业关注的焦点,对象存储和文件存储作为两种常见的存储方式,各有其特点和优势,本文将从应用场景和区别两个方面对对象存储与文件存储进行解析。

对象存储与文件存储的区别

1、存储结构

对象存储采用分布式存储架构,将数据分割成多个对象,每个对象包含元数据、数据和唯一标识符,对象存储系统通过哈希算法将对象映射到存储节点,实现数据的高效存储和访问。

文件存储采用树形目录结构,将数据以文件形式存储在磁盘中,文件存储系统通过文件路径访问数据,便于用户管理和组织。

对象储存和文件储存的区别,对象存储与文件存储,应用场景解析及区别探讨

2、扩展性

对象存储具有良好的扩展性,可通过增加存储节点来提升存储容量和性能,文件存储的扩展性相对较差,需要升级硬件设备或增加存储节点才能提高性能。

3、访问方式

对象存储支持HTTP/HTTPS协议,可通过RESTful API进行访问,文件存储通常采用文件系统访问方式,如NFS、CIFS等。

4、数据处理

对象存储支持数据的元数据管理、版本控制、权限控制等功能,文件存储在数据管理方面相对较弱,主要依靠操作系统和第三方工具进行管理。

对象存储的应用场景

1、大数据存储

对象存储适用于大规模数据存储,如海量图片、视频、文档等,其分布式存储架构和良好的扩展性,能够满足大数据应用对存储性能和容量的需求。

对象储存和文件储存的区别,对象存储与文件存储,应用场景解析及区别探讨

2、云计算平台

对象存储是云计算平台的重要组成部分,为虚拟机、容器等资源提供持久化存储服务,通过对象存储,云计算平台能够实现资源的弹性伸缩和高效管理。

3、跨地域数据备份

对象存储支持数据跨地域备份,可实现数据的灾难恢复,企业可将重要数据存储在多个地域的对象存储系统中,降低数据丢失风险。

4、物联网数据存储

对象存储适用于物联网场景,可存储海量传感器数据,其高性能和低成本特点,有助于降低物联网设备的运营成本。

文件存储的应用场景

1、文件共享与协作

文件存储适用于文件共享和协作场景,如企业内部文档、图片、视频等,用户可通过文件路径访问和操作文件,实现高效的数据共享。

对象储存和文件储存的区别,对象存储与文件存储,应用场景解析及区别探讨

2、传统的企业级应用

文件存储适用于传统的企业级应用,如ERP、CRM等,这些应用对数据访问速度和稳定性要求较高,文件存储能够满足其需求。

3、数据归档

文件存储适用于数据归档场景,如历史数据、备份数据等,通过文件存储,企业能够方便地查询和恢复归档数据。

对象存储和文件存储在存储结构、扩展性、访问方式等方面存在差异,适用于不同的应用场景,企业在选择存储方式时,应根据自身需求、预算和性能要求进行综合考虑,随着技术的发展,对象存储和文件存储将相互融合,为用户提供更加便捷、高效的存储解决方案。

黑狐家游戏

发表评论

最新文章